React is a JavaScript library created by a collaboration of Facebook and Instagram. React הופכת את היצירה של ממשקי משתמש אינטראקטיביים לנוחה יותר. This one is among the best React Native component libraries if what you’re looking for are some icons to use in your apps. All the functions used in the library, along with variables, even HTML templates to be appended, are wrapped up into a class in the .js file. With a library of 3,000+ icons you’re pretty much sure to find something that will fit your needs. React is a JavaScript library, and so we’ll assume you have a basic understanding of the JavaScript language. Determining Library Compatibility What’s more, it’s possible to customize, style, and extend the icons while integrating them in your project. It is currently one of the most popular JavaScript front-end libraries which has a strong foundation and a large community supporting it. For example, let's say there's a javascript library that embeds a simple widget to my webpage. Its aim is to allow developers to create fast user interfaces easily. React Native is one of many JavaScript programming environments, including Node.js, web browsers, Electron, and more, and npm includes libraries that work for all of these environments. Design simple views for each state in your application, and React will efficiently update and render just the right components when your data changes. ... I’m going to present to you my top of JavaScript libraries that greatly simplify working with data. Redux helps you write applications that behave consistently, run in different environments (client, server, and native), and are easy to test. However, this doesn't help much - especially when the JavaScript landscape is changing so rapidly. Similar to (and inspired by) Facebook's Flux architecture, it was created by Dan Abramov and Andrew Clark. React makes no assumptions about the rest of the technology stack used, thus it's easy to try it out on a small feature in an existing project. So, in this article I will try to answer this basic question and list down 5 simple libraries for making AJAX calls in React.

It determines updates based on its own internal representation, and if the same DOM nodes are manipulated by another library, React gets confused and has no way to recover. You can use React Native today in your existing Android and iOS projects or you can create a whole new app from scratch. jQuery $.ajax. or even better: ... React is second most Popular JavaScript Library on Earth with 128k+ stars. React has a few different kinds of components, but we’ll start with React.Component subclasses: If you don’t feel very confident, we recommend going through a JavaScript tutorial to check your knowledge level and enable you to follow along this guide without getting lost. A JavaScript library for building user interfaces.

React is a declarative, efficient, and flexible JavaScript library for building user interfaces.

A JavaScript library for building user interfaces.